After many years of fundraising and seeking sponsorship, The Leiston Film Theatre Support club in association with the Leiston Film Theatre are pleased to announce that their 'Set the Stage Campaign' is now well under way with the installation of a state of the art digital projector and the erection of a stage frame onto the theatres' stage. All of  these improvements are going to go a long way to enhance patrons cinema and live show experience. The frame will enable us to become more ambitious with a greater range of effects, such as smoke machines and glitter cannons, set designs such as extra set cloths, particularly helpful for our Pantomimes, allowing for quick scene changes.  The frame will also allow  us a greater range of lighting, including  the use of colour which we have unfortunately  lacked in the past.

The next major part of Set the Stage was the installation of a permanent building at the rear of the Leiston Film Theatre.  This building, (which looks a lot like a double garage, but isn't) will be used a storeroom and workshop for sets and also if necessary as a third dressing room, again this is all possible due to the hard work of the Support Club, so a big thank you to them.

Update - June 07: The Workshop is up and functional, it was first used by the Angel Players for as an overflow dressing room during their recent hit show 'A handful of songs'.
